Amethyst is a purple variety of quartz that gets its color from irradiation and inclusions of iron in the crystal lattice

This mineral gets its name from Mount Vesuvius, where it was first discovered within near lavas. Vasonite is typically green but also can be found as green, brown, yellow, or blue. The crystals are short pyramidal to long prismatic crystals containing a vitreous to resinous luster. These pieces are polished into the shape of a sphere. You will receive one
